Electric power iron tower staple bolt of acting as go-between convenient to installation Technical Field The utility model belongs to the technical field of stay wire hoops, and particularly relates to an electric power iron tower stay wire hoop convenient to install. Background The stay wire anchor ear is a key fastener for fixing an electric pole or an iron tower stay wire in an electric power system, and reliable connection of the stay wire and the pole body is realized through a flat steel structure. At present, the wire rod of staple bolt of acting as go-between is fixed in one side of the body of rod often, easily produces under high altitude environment and rocks, applys the pulling force of back to the body of rod to the staple bolt simultaneously, appears connecting the not hard up condition easily. The utility model has the following beneficial effects: According to the utility model, the clamping piece is arranged in the hoop main body, after the hoop is installed, the acting force of the wire rod can be transmitted to the other side of the rod body from the connecting plate and the pressing plate, and the acting force generated by the shaking of the wire rod directly acts on the rod body, so that the hoop main body cannot be directly influenced, and the installation stability of the hoop main body is ensured. According to the wire rod turning device, the wire rod is fixed in the positioning groove through the pressing of the pressing plate and the support plate, so that the wire rod turns around the rod body when the wire rod needing to be turned is installed, and the pull force generated by turning acts on the rod body, so that the wire rod installed in the turning is more stable, and the use quality is improved.
